What is the best seasoning for grilled salmon on a gas grill?

Blends with citrus, dill, and a touch of smoke work best. For example, Johnny’s Alaskan Salmon Seasoning combines lemon peel, garlic, and onion for a bright finish that stands up to gas grill heat. Avoid heavy sugar-based rubs that can burn quickly at high temperatures.

Can I use a dry rub on salmon before grilling?

Yes, dry rubs are ideal for gas grilling. They form a crust that locks in moisture. Just pat the salmon dry, apply the rub, and let it sit for 10-15 minutes before placing it on the grill. How long should I season salmon before grilling on a gas grill?

20-30 minutes is ideal. This allows the spices to penetrate the surface without drawing out too much moisture. For thicker fillets, you can go up to an hour. But avoid overnight marinating with citrus-heavy blends, as the acid can start to cook the fish.

Do I need to oil the salmon before applying seasoning?

A light coat of oil helps the rub stick and prevents sticking to the grill grates. Use avocado or canola oil for high heat. Then sprinkle your best seasoning for grilled salmon on gas grill blend evenly. This also helps create that crispy golden crust.
